Identity Authentication Solutions Firm Trusfort Raises RMB 120 Mln Series B2
36Kr.com, 1/15/18
Beijing-based mobile identity authentication service provider Trusfort Technology recently revealed that it completed RMB 120 mln in Series B2 funding in December 2017, in a round led by Yunfeng Capital with participation from Dreamfly Capital Management, SIG Asia Investment, and Redpoint Ventures.
Trusfort's basic product line is mobile multifactor authentication (MFA) and intelligent behavior authentication (IPA) with the two businesses complementing each other. Previously, after users entered an account and password, the enterprise's server would verify the information, but with Trusfort adds a new layer of security with a certificate generated on the user's handset. A unique ID, which can take the form of a key or character string, is generated from more than 5,000 features along 20 dimensions, including SIM card, time, account, data, and apps.
Trusfort currently serves more than 100 large and mid-sized enterprise clients, covering nearly 100 mln mobile users, and protecting tens of millions of users per day on average. Trusfort has recovered as much as RMB 100 mln in accumulated direct economic damages for its clients to date.
Trusfort currently has revenue of nearly RMB 100 mln, and in 2018 plans to create solutions for several core industries in 2018, as well as to continue building its team with the establishment of an R&D department in Wuhan.
